CVE-2005-4881

The netlink subsystem in the Linux kernel 2.4.x before 2.4.37.6 and 2.6.x before 2.6.13-rc1 does not initialize certain padding fields in structures, which might allow local users to obtain sensitive information from kernel memory via unspecified vectors, related to the 1 tcfillqdisc, 2...

CVE-2005-4881

CVE-2005-4881 is a Linux kernel netlink padding init flaw affecting 2.4.x (pre-2.4.37.6) and 2.6.x (pre-2.6.13-rc1). The issue left padding fields uninitialized in netlink-related structures (e.g., tc_fill_qdisc, tcf_fill_node, inet6_fill_ifinfo, __nlmsg_put, __rta_reserve, etc.), enabling local ...
